Your future duties and responsibilities:
- Contributes to the design, development, and deployment of various projects and initiatives within Splunk to enhance the security posture and capabilities of the Corporate Security team. Ensures all activities conducted are in compliance with governing regulations, internal policies and procedures.
- Assist in the planning, execution, and delivery of Splunk development projects and analytics initiatives in support of investigations, criminal activity, and risk mitigation.
- Onboarding data in diverse formats into Splunk from various source systems by defining and configuring data inputs and settings to ensure data accuracy and completeness.
- Develop queries using Splunk SPL based on business requirements, working with large datasets to provide insights that are thoroughly tested and validated prior to deployment.
- Design and develop dashboards, alerts, reports, and visualizations in Splunk to meet business needs, ensuring they are user-friendly and actionable.
- Provide troubleshooting support by diagnosing and resolving Splunk-related issues.
